Second Battle of Bull Run (aug 28, 1862 – aug 30, 1862)

Description:

The Second Battle of Bull Run took place from August 28 to August 30 of 1862 in Virginia, and involved the Confederates fighting against the Union. During the battle, newer models of muskets were used which had greater accuracy than previous models, as well as the telegraph which made communication quicker and easier. The outcome of the battle was the Confederates beating the Union and allowed for a Confederate invasion into the North. This event affected the outcome of the war as it allowed the Confederates to launch an invasion into the North while scoring a big defeat onto the Union. This was important as it severely damaged northern morale and stopped the Union from capturing the Confederate capital of Richmond.
